However, the cost of education and training programs can of...In November 1979, revolutionaries stormed the American embassy in Tehran and held 52 Americans hostage. The Carter administration tried unsuccessfully to negotiate for the hostages release. On January 20, 1981, the day Carter left office, Iran released the Americans, ending their 444 days in captivity.The commander in - chief of the continental army was ____. George Washington. Eastern Gateway College ...a political organization within the Democratic Party in New York city (late 1800's and early 1900's) seeking political control by corruption and bossism. Boss Tweed. William Tweed, head of Tammany Hall, NYC's powerful democratic political machine in 1868.
